18th Century Baroque Commode, Germany, 1750-1760
About the Item
18th century Baroque commode, probably Mainz (Germany), 1750. Body on flattened ball feet, serpentine front with three drawers, each of them with escutcheons and ring handles. Molded and overhanging top. Walnut veneer with plum inlays. The commode is in very good condition, it has been professionally refinished.
